HMI(Human Machine Interface,人机界面)和PLC(Programmable Logic Controller,可编程逻辑控制器)是工业自动化系统中两个关键的组成部分,它们在功能、应用场景和设计目标上有着显著的区别。
1. 功能与用途
-
HMI:HMI主要用于人与机器之间的交互。它通常是一个图形化的界面,允许操作员监控和控制工业过程。HMI可以显示实时数据、报警信息、历史记录等,并提供按钮、滑块、菜单等控件,供操作员输入指令或调整参数。HMI的核心功能是提供一个直观、易用的界面,使操作员能够轻松地与复杂的自动化系统进行交互。
-
PLC:PLC是一种专门设计用于工业环境的计算机控制系统。它的主要功能是根据预设的逻辑程序,控制和监控各种工业设备和过程。PLC能够接收来自传感器和开关的输入信号,执行逻辑运算、顺序控制、定时、计数等操作,并输出控制信号以驱动执行机构(如电机、阀门等)。PLC的核心功能是实现自动化控制,确保生产过程的稳定性和效率。
2. 设计目标
-
HMI:HMI的设计目标是提供一个用户友好的界面,使操作员能够快速理解和操作复杂的控制系统。HMI通常需要考虑用户体验(UX)设计,确保界面布局合理、信息清晰、操作简便。HMI的硬件通常包括触摸屏、键盘、鼠标等输入设备,软件则包括图形界面设计工具和数据处理引擎。
-
PLC:PLC的设计目标是实现高可靠性和实时性的控制。PLC通常工作在恶劣的工业环境中,因此需要具备抗干扰、抗振动、耐高温等特性。PLC的硬件包括中央处理器(CPU)、输入/输出模块、电源模块等,软件则包括编程环境(如 ladder logic、structured text等)和运行时系统。
3. 应用场景
-
HMI:HMI广泛应用于各种工业领域,如制造业、能源、交通、医疗等。例如,在一个汽车制造工厂中,HMI可以用于监控生产线上的各个环节,显示机器状态、生产进度、故障报警等信息,并允许操作员通过触摸屏或键盘输入指令,调整生产参数或启动/停止设备。
-
PLC:PLC同样广泛应用于工业自动化领域。例如,在一个水处理厂中,PLC可以用于控制水泵的启停、阀门的开关、液位的监测等。PLC能够根据预设的逻辑程序,自动调节水处理过程,确保水质达标并优化能源消耗。
4. 案例分析
-
HMI案例:假设在一个食品加工厂中,HMI被用于监控和控制一条自动化包装线。操作员可以通过HMI界面实时查看每个包装环节的状态,如填充量、封口质量、标签粘贴等。如果某个环节出现异常,HMI会立即显示报警信息,并提供相应的处理建议。操作员还可以通过HMI调整包装速度、填充量等参数,以适应不同的生产需求。
-
PLC案例:在一个钢铁厂中,PLC被用于控制高温炉的温度和压力。PLC通过接收来自温度传感器和压力传感器的信号,实时调整燃气阀门的开度,确保炉内温度和压力保持在设定范围内。PLC还能够根据生产计划,自动切换不同的加热模式,以提高能源利用率和生产效率。
总结
HMI和PLC在工业自动化系统中扮演着不同的角色。HMI主要负责人机交互,提供直观、易用的操作界面;而PLC则负责实现自动化控制,确保生产过程的稳定性和效率。两者相辅相成,共同构成了现代工业自动化系统的基础。